What is CVE-2026-85893?

A use-after-free vulnerability exists in Microsoft Edge (Chromium-based) that could allow an attacker to elevate their privileges over a network. This flaw can be exploited to gain unauthorized access and control over the affected system, compromising user data and network integrity. It is crucial for users to update their Edge browser to the latest version to mitigate the risks associated with this vulnerability.

Affected Version(s)

Microsoft Edge (Chromium-based) 1.0.0.0 < 153.0.4234.32
